.texts{font-size:12px;line-height:133%;}
.textsw{font-size:12px;line-height:150%;}
.textm{font-size:14px;line-height:125%;}
.textmw{font-size:14px;line-height:150%;}
.textl{font-size:18px;line-height:125%;}
.textll{font-size:20px;line-height:125%;}
.textlll{font-size:22px;line-height:125%;}


/*ナビ用CSS*/
#study #nav p{
margin:10px 0;
padding:0;
color:#333333;
margin-left:15px;
font-size:12px;
line-height:150%;
}
#study #nav div h3{
margin:0;
padding:0;
width:100%;
height:55px;
display:block;
}
#study #nav div h3 a{
margin:0;
padding:0;
width:100%;
height:55px;
display:block;
text-indent:-9999px;
}
#study #nav div h3 a{
border-top:1px solid #DAE5F4;
border-left:1px solid #DAE5F4;
border-right:1px solid #CCCCCC;
border-bottom:1px solid #CCCCCC;
}
#study #nav div h3 a:hover,
#study #nav div h3 a:active{
border:1px solid #1E4EA7;
}
#study #nav .n01,.n02,.n03,.n04,.n05,.n06{
background:url(../img/nav_bg.jpg) top left repeat-x;
}

#study #nav .n01 h3 a{
background:url(../img/nav01.jpg) top left no-repeat;
}
#study #nav .n01 h3 a:hover,
#study #nav .n01 h3 a:active{
background:url(../img/nav01.jpg) no-repeat 0px -55px;
}

#study #nav .n02 h3 a{
background:url(../img/nav02.jpg) top left no-repeat;
}
#study #nav .n02 h3 a:hover,
#study #nav .n02 h3 a:active{
background:url(../img/nav02.jpg) no-repeat 0px -55px;
}

#study #nav .n03 h3 a{
background:url(../img/nav03.jpg) top left no-repeat;
}
#study #nav .n03 h3 a:hover,
#study #nav .n03 h3 a:active{
background:url(../img/nav03.jpg) no-repeat 0px -55px;
}

#study #nav .n04 h3 a{
background:url(../img/nav04.jpg) top left no-repeat;
}
#study #nav .n04 h3 a:hover,
#study #nav .n04 h3 a:active{
background:url(../img/nav04.jpg) no-repeat 0px -55px;
}

#study #nav .n05 h3 a{
background:url(../img/nav05.jpg) top left no-repeat;
}
#study #nav .n05 h3 a:hover,
#study #nav .n05 h3 a:active{
background:url(../img/nav05.jpg) no-repeat 0px -55px;
}

#study #nav .n06 h3 a{
background:url(../img/nav06.jpg) top left no-repeat;
}
#study #nav .n06 h3 a:hover,
#study #nav .n06 h3 a:active{
background:url(../img/nav06.jpg) no-repeat 0px -55px;
}
